#ffda90 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ffda90 is composed of 100% red, 85.5%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 14.5% magenta, 43.5%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 40 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 78.2%. #ffda90 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ffb521.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

#ffda90 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ffda90 has RGB values of R:255, G:218,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.15, Y:0.44, K:0. Its decimal value is 16767632.
